In a method for producing liquid pig iron (16) and a sponge metal from
charging substances comprising iron ore (4) respectively metal ore, the
charging substances are directly reduced to sponge iron in at least one
first reduction zone (2) the sponge iron is melted in a melt-down
gasifying zone (15) under the supply of carbon carriers (10) and
oxygen-containing gas and a CO-- and H.sub.2 -containing reducing gas is
produced which is fed to the first reduction zone (2), is reacted there
and withdrawn as a top gas, wherein the withdrawn top gas after a
scrubbing operation is subjected to CO.sub.2 elimination and optionally to
heating and is supplied to at least one further reduction zone (27) for
the direct reduction of metal ore, in particular of iron ore (26), as a
reducing gas that is at least largely free from CO.sub.2 and after
reaction with the metal ore (26) is withdrawn as an export gas and
purified in a scrubber. In order to exploit the sludges incurring in the
scrubbers while expending as little energy as possible, the sludges
obtained in the scrubbing of the top gas from the first reduction zone (2)
are dewatered and charged into the melter gasifier (15), whereas the
sludges obtained in the scrubbing of the export gas of the further
reduction zone (27) are dewatered and fed into the first direct reduction
zone (2).
